First Impressions: The Opening Notes

The initial spritz of No.04 Bois de Balincourt is an immediate embrace of warm, woody notes. Top notes of sandalwood and cedar create a creamy, slightly spicy introduction that feels both grounding and sophisticated. This is a scent that doesn't shout; it whispers with quiet confidence, making it perfect for those who prefer understated elegance. The opening is smooth and inviting, with a subtle hint of vetiver adding a touch of earthiness.

In contrast, No.14 Icila opens with a burst of fresh, luminous florals. The top notes feature bergamot and pink pepper, which add a sparkling, slightly zesty lift before the heart of jasmine and rose unfolds. This is a more extroverted opening, one that announces its presence with grace and charm. The floral bouquet is balanced by a hint of pear, lending a subtle fruitiness that softens the overall composition. If Bois de Balincourt is a cozy cabin in the woods, Icila is a sunlit garden in full bloom.

  • No.04 Bois de Balincourt: creamy sandalwood, cedar, vetiver – warm and earthy.
  • No.14 Icila: bergamot, pink pepper, jasmine, rose – fresh and floral.

Heart and Soul: The Development

As No.04 Bois de Balincourt settles, the heart reveals a rich blend of amber and musk, which adds depth and sensuality. The sandalwood remains prominent, but it's now joined by a subtle smokiness that gives the fragrance a mysterious edge. This is a scent that evolves slowly, rewarding those who take the time to experience its layers. It's the kind of perfume that feels like a second skin – intimate and personal.

No.14 Icila, on the other hand, blooms into a full floral heart with jasmine sambac and tuberose taking center stage. The floral notes are lush and opulent, yet they retain a certain airiness thanks to the underlying white musk. A touch of vanilla in the base adds a creamy sweetness that lingers softly. This fragrance is more linear in its development, maintaining its floral character throughout, but it remains captivating and elegant from start to finish.

  • No.04 Bois de Balincourt: amber, musk, subtle smokiness – deep and evolving.
  • No.14 Icila: jasmine sambac, tuberose, vanilla – lush and consistent.

Longevity and Sillage: How They Perform

When it comes to lasting power, both Eaux de Parfum perform admirably, but they behave differently on the skin. No.04 Bois de Balincourt typically lasts 6 to 8 hours, with a moderate sillage that projects softly for the first few hours before becoming a closer skin scent. It's ideal for office wear or intimate settings where you want a subtle but noticeable presence. The woody base notes tend to cling to fabric, extending the wear time on clothes.

No.14 Icila offers similar longevity, often lasting 6 to 7 hours, but its sillage is slightly more pronounced due to the floral notes. The initial projection is moderate, creating a lovely scent bubble that garners compliments without being overwhelming. As it dries down, it becomes softer but remains detectable. For those who enjoy a fragrance that leaves a trail, Icila might be the better choice. Both perfumes benefit from moisturizing the skin before application to enhance longevity.

  • No.04 Bois de Balincourt: 6-8 hours, moderate sillage, becomes intimate.
  • No.14 Icila: 6-7 hours, slightly stronger sillage, floral presence lingers.

Seasonality and Occasion: When to Wear Each

No.04 Bois de Balincourt is a year-round fragrance but truly shines in fall and winter. Its warm, woody profile complements cozy sweaters and cooler temperatures, making it an excellent choice for evening events, date nights, or any occasion where you want to feel sophisticated and grounded. It's also versatile enough for daytime wear in colder months, adding a touch of comfort to your daily routine.

No.14 Icila is quintessentially spring and summer. Its fresh, floral character is perfect for daytime outings, brunches, garden parties, or vacations. The bright, uplifting notes evoke a sense of joy and femininity that pairs beautifully with warm weather. However, its lightness also makes it suitable for transitional seasons like early autumn. If you love florals, this could easily become your go-to for any occasion that calls for a touch of elegance.

  • No.04 Bois de Balincourt: best for fall/winter, evenings, and intimate settings.
  • No.14 Icila: ideal for spring/summer, daytime, and social events.
